Savi's Workshop update week of 1/10/2022

Has anyone built a light saber this week? Wondering if they got the black cases back in stock or if they are still using lame plastic bags.

Can’t say for sure. We built on 1/9/22 and it was plastic sleeves.

We went back on 1/10/22 to purchase the upgraded carrying case in Dok-Ondar’s and noticed they were still using plastic sleeves over at Savis.

I am late to respond but my son attended the workshop on January 12th and they were still out. We purchased a padded carrying case from the gift shop above the class and it is perfect.
